Accommodations
There are numerous hotel options available. Six local hotels have partnered with Bethany Lutheran College as corporate sponsors and offer special rates for Bethany guests. Ask about these rates when you set your reservation. Visit the accommodations page for lodging options or see a map of Mankato and favorite places according to Bethany students.
Need Ride to Campus?
Land to Air EXPRESS, a shuttle from Minneapolis, St. Paul, Rochester and the MSP airport is available to visitors going to and from Mankato. Visitors using this shuttle service from the airport may get reimbursed for the cost of their trip through the Admissions Office if contacted in advance.
Uber and Lyft make in-town travel easy; but if you prefer a taxi service, call Kato Cab at 507-388-7433. Mankato also has an extensive public bus system.
